Mulder Shipyard in the Netherlands has announced that construction will soon start on a new yard. This second yard will cover an area of 7000 square metres and focus on the maintenance, refit and new build of yachts between 18 and 40 metres. It should be ready to start operations in 2012, with the first new yacht launching in 2013.
